My Background and Approach
Dr. Foresman pulls from her psychodynamically-oriented training and incorporates elements of interpersonal psychotherapy, motivational interviewing, cognitive-behavioral strategies as well as mindfulness techniques into her work. Her work is client-focused and she works to cater therapy to each individuals needs, meeting where they are at that time. She works to help individuals gain a better understanding of themselves, what motivates their actions and relationship styles in an effort to work towards positive change. Dr. Foresman has experience working with a diverse client population and takes pride in providing a safe space for POC and LGBTQ+ individuals. Dr. Foresman graduated with a B.S. in Psychology from Virginia Tech in 2008, completed her Masters and Doctoral Degree in Clinical Psychology at The George Washington University, graduating in August 2012. Dr. Foresman then completed her training with a post-doc at the University of Virginia.
